Jo-Ann Stores, LLC, (stylized JOANN) was an American specialty retail chain that specialized in fabrics and arts and crafts supplies. The chain was based in Hudson, Ohio and operated over 800 stores across 49 U.S. states. By the end of February 2025, the company began the process of liquidating all of its stores after failing to obtain a buyer. Two hundred fifty-five of the chain's stores were shuttered by the end of April, while the remaining 535 locations were permanently closed by May 30, 2025. Surname: Cabral
Portuguese
Cabral is a surname of Portuguese origin, coming from the word Cabra meaning goat. The surname Cabral most commonly came from goat farmers.
